J'ai postulé via un recruteur. Le processus a pris 2 semaines. J'ai passé un entretien chez Amazon (Seattle, WA) en janv. 2012
Entretien
Had first round phone interview. Interviewer was a Dev Manager in amazon.com website team. Asked a lot of computer science/algorithm/data structure questions. Expected to provide the cost of the algorithm. Given a problem over phone and asked to choose the right data structure and explain why it would be more efficient than others. This stuff can be explained by computer science grads who are out of college in the last few years. I could answer most of the questions but not as fluently since I was out of touch with this for a long time.
Questions d'entretien [1]
Question 1
There are 100 million records to search through in memory. What data structure would you use? Explain in detail why you would choose that over others?